> Q1: Can I operate a scanner on the same SCSI bus as my CD-RW & Zip
>     drives ?  Will any SCSI-II scanner work ?
>
> A1: SCSI-I scanners hold on to the SCSI bus for times you
>     can measure on a wristwatch.  No other device connected to the same
>     SCSI bus will work while you are scanning.  If you do need to use
>     other SCSI devices while scanning, you could end up with
>     three or more SCSI busses on your machine: one for the scanner,
>     one for slow-ish SCSI devices like CDRW, Zip and one for fast SCSI
>     disk & tape drives.
>
>     Seems like SCSI-II scanners should work, but I don't know
>     if they do.  With data rates in the 1 megabyte/s ballpark,
>     they shouldn't be close to saturating a SCSI-II bus.
>     If there's a problem, why is it there ?
>
>     Or is SCSI I/II a red herring ?  I thought SCSI-I devices
>     were supposed to be able to disconnect/reconnect?
I don`t know any scanners that support disconnect/reconnect.
The UMAX Astras 1220S does not support it!
You are able to use the other scsi devices on the same bus with
the UMAX scanners. But I would NOT start a scan while burning a CD.
The UMAX scanners do block the scsi bus for some (1-3) seconds
at the start of the scan. While scanning the bus is not totally blocked
but it gets slower.

> Q2: Are there any well-known SCSI cards that I should particularly
>     avoid ?  What SCSI-card should I get ?
>
> A2: Don't use a scanner on an ultra-scsi bus.  Expensive cables &
>     active termination required.  Problematic.   Just don't think about
> it.
>
>     Use a SCSI-II (Fast SCSI) PCI card, with a reasonably inteligent
>     controller chip (e.g. 53C8xx, 53C9xx, Adaptec etc).
>     Support for wide SCSI-II is not relevant - neither an advantage
>     nor a disadvantage.
>
>     The above comments apply equally to external CD drives, CDRW, Zip,
>     and other scsi devices which don't need or support the speed of
>     SCSI-III (Ultra-SCSI).
>
>     Scanners (and CDRW) are often supplied with ancient ISA-bus SCSI
> cards.
>     These cards should be disposed of with due care for the environment,
>     or mounted on your wall.
>
The UMAX Astra 1220S normally comes with an ISA scsi card.
It does work a bit with linux but it really is not a good solution.
I suggest a good but relative cheap scsi card like the ncr/symbios logic
53c810 or 53c815 cards.

> Q4: Is it required or desirable to configure my Linux kernel
>     in a non standard way ?
>
> A4: Basically no.  You need to configure generic SCSI support
>     and support for whatever SCSI controller(s) you intend to use.
>
>     ??Changing SG_BIG_BUF may or may not help??
>
>     Further information may be found in the doc for the backend
>     for your scanner.
>
increasing SG_BIG_BUF  helps til  kernel 2.2.5
kernel-2.2.6 and above dynamically set the buffer size.
